Exposed brick and steel is the whole job here, because neither of them presents a flat plane to scribe to. Pieces are cut, mitred, machined and dry-assembled on the bench before anything is loaded onto a van. The drawing decides it before the saw does.

The newer blocks along the navigation have compact single-wall kitchens in an open-plan living room.

Older converted units often have a wide roller shutter at ground level, which is the easiest slab entry anywhere in the borough, but the upper live-work floors are reached by an open industrial stair. Access is off narrow industrial roads with working yards and gates that get locked outside hours, so a delivery slot has to be agreed with the building manager. Warehouse and live-work units have the kitchen as a free-standing block in an otherwise open shell, so it is long straight runs with an exposed island and full-height end panels rather than anything fitted into a corner.

The goods lift is generous and the flat entrance often is not, so the tightest point on the route is inside the flat rather than in the building. The kitchen is open plan and the island is often long enough to need a join, and it sits in the middle of the room where every edge is visible, so the join goes over a gable and usually under the hob line where the eye does not follow it. Worktop fabrication, in short

  • Slabs come in finite sizes, so a long run needs a join.
  • Joins sit over a cabinet gable, never spanning a gap or running through a cut-out.
  • A finished join is typically 2–3mm, colour-matched and sanded flush.
  • Your sink and hob are dry-fitted on the bench before dispatch.

Getting stone into the room

Stone goes up on edge, and it is the half-landing turn rather than the flight itself that sets the maximum piece. Getting that wrong leaves a finished, machined piece that cannot reach the room, which is a remake rather than a trim. The drawing carries that decision through to the saw.

Seating overhangs past roughly 300mm will not carry on the carcass alone, so flat steel bar or a plywood substrate has to be built into the units first. The nest is laid out around that, with joins placed over cabinet gables and kept clear of every cut-out. That is nested before any glass goes on the saw. Material is £110-£550 per square metre supply only, and templating, fabrication and fitting are quoted on their own lines.

A deep scribe comes out of the nest, so how far the stone has to be relieved changes which part of the slab the piece is cut from. Cut it square where it should be radiused and the piece will fail on the lift, not in the kitchen. Radiused, polished, and clear of the joins. The island layout, including whether the ends are mitred down to the floor, needs settling before cutting, since mitred ends are cut in sequence with the top and dry-assembled as one unit. Quartz is the sensible default in a rental: nothing to seal, nothing to maintain, and nothing an incoming tenant needs briefing on. Sink and hob are dry-fitted on the bench before dispatch, whoever supplied them. Dry-assembled before it leaves.
